What does a separate distribution system accomplish during degraded operations?

Final answer:

A separate distribution system during degraded operations helps maintain power supply to critical facilities, provides backup power, and minimizes the impact of faults.

Step-by-step explanation:

A separate distribution system during degraded operations accomplishes several things:

  1. It helps to maintain reliability and continuity of power supply to critical facilities or essential loads even when the main power system is facing issues or failures.
  2. It provides a backup power source that can be activated during emergencies or outages, ensuring that essential services are not disrupted.
  3. It allows for isolating and minimizing the impact of faults or disturbances in the main power system, reducing the extent of downtime and improving overall system performance.
